About the role
Please note this role is a 1 year Maternity cover.
We are seeking an experienced Change Manager to play a key role in shaping how UCL designs, delivers, and sustains change. Working within the Strategic Change team, you will deliver change management activity across one or more projects, ensuring the successful adoption of new ways of working.
You will develop and deliver robust change plans and compelling communication and engagement plans; manage change readiness; and coach leaders and teams to embed change effectively. The role may involve supporting a broad range of change initiatives, including digital, process, and people-focused change (organisational design). Examples of transformation initiatives include revolutionising our timetable capability and improving our services for students and staff.

What we offer
As well as the exciting opportunities this role presents, we also offer some great benefits some of which are below:
1. 41 Days holiday (27 days annual leave 8 bank holiday and 6 closure days)
2. Additional 5 days’ annual leave purchase scheme
3. Defined benefit career average revalued earnings pension scheme (CARE)
4. Cycle to work scheme and season ticket loan
5. Immigration loan
6. Relocation scheme for certain posts
7. On-Site nursery
8. On-site gym
9. Enhanced maternity, paternity and adoption pay
10. Employee assistance programme: Staff Support Service
11. Discounted medical insurance
